Most of us assume cockroaches avoid humans, and for good reason: their primary diet consists of decaying organic matter, not flesh. But in rare situations—especially during food shortages or extreme living conditions—cockroaches have been documented biting human skin. These bites are most commonly reported on exposed areas like fingers, toes, lips, and sometimes the face.

What Cockroach Bites Feel Like
Since these encounters are uncommon, information about symptoms is sparse. But those who’ve reported roach bites describe sensations like:
- A faint stinging or burning immediately after the bite.
- Red, rounded welts appearing hours later.
- Itching that worsens over time, sometimes leading to secondary infections if scratched.
Risk Factors You Should Recognize
- Dense infestations: A crowded cockroach population increases the chance of contact.
- Food access: Spilled crumbs, open pantry items, and poor sanitation invite roaches closer to humans.
- Entrance points: Cracks in walls, open doors, or poor sealing allow roaches into living spaces—and bites.

How to Protect Yourself From Hidden Threats
- Seal cracks and entry points around your home.
- Store food in airtight containers.
- Clean regularly to eliminate roach magnets like crumbs and grease.
- Use traps and professional pest control when needed.
